  • Patent number: 9873091
    Abstract: The invention relates to a membrane having a pore-free separating layer including a polymer mixture for separating simple alcohols and water from their mixtures with other organic fluids by means of pervaporation or vapor permeation. In accordance with the invention, the polymer mixture is composed of at least two polymer components which are taken from the group of polymer components which includes of the following polymer components: Polyvinyl alcohol, other polymers such as poly N—N-dimethylaminoethyl methacrylate (poly DMAEMA), a copolymer of DMAEMA and N-vinyl pyrrolidone (NVP) or of DMAEMA and N-vinyl caprolactam (NVCL), a terpolymer of DMAE, NVP and NVCL or of vinyl acetate ethylene vinyl chloride or from vinyl chloride ethylene acrylic ester or from vinyl acetate vinyl chloride acrylic ester. The invention further relates to the use and to a method for manufacturing a membrane in accordance with the invention.

  • Patent number: 8256626
    Abstract: A composite membrane is provided for the separation of water with at least one separation layer of cross-linked polyvinyl alcohol, with the separation layer being subjected in a separate process step to a post-crosslinking operation with an acid or an acid-releasing compound and at least one dialdehyde.
